Transaction 050ed68117ddba6c529c18da95b6aec39c11d38bbb345a126eee6450da1b4ef9

2 Input
2 Outputs
  • 050ed68117ddba6c529c18da95b6aec39c11d38bbb345a126eee6450da1b4ef9:0
  • value  14982
    address  3JTwwbHFXpDDFZTsG8XjYme7LR9zXjmp6K
  • 050ed68117ddba6c529c18da95b6aec39c11d38bbb345a126eee6450da1b4ef9:1
  • value  2188000
    address  3Fy1ajyBSfAqvn8HDFYKMHNJRSCdQP6HcL